British engineers help to save WWII Dornier Do-17 German bomber from its last battle – Corrosion

Researchers from Imperial College London are working with the Royal Air Force Museum to clean the Dornier Do-17, known as The Flying Pencil (Fliegender Bleistift), and prevent further corrosion once it is removed from the water. In 2010, shifting sands … Continue reading
